WebHelm Name Meaning English (Lancashire): from Old English helm ‘protection covering’ (in later northern English dialects ‘cattle shelter barn’). The name may be topographic for someone who lived by or worked at a barn or habitational from a place so named such as Helme in Meltham (Yorkshire). English: variant of Elm with prosthetic H-.
